Details

Based on on interview, observation, and record review, conducted during a site visit on 07/01/24, it was confirmed the facility failed to fully implement and update an Acuity Based Staffing Tool (ABST) for 3 of 3 sampled residents (#s 2, 3, and 4). Findings include, but are not limited to:


In an interview with Staff 1 (RN) on 07/01/24, s/he stated the facility used a "staffing matrix" to determine the staffing needs for any given day.


A review of the facility's ABST showed a need for 52.53 care staff hours.


An observation of the staff present for day shift on 07/01/24 showed 45.5 care staff hours were scheduled for that day.


A review of the facility's ABST revealed Resident 4, who admitted on 06/25/24, was not entered into the tool as of 07/01/24.


In an interview, Staff 1 stated the facility's expectation for answering calls was within 10 minutes.


A review of call light logs for Resident 3, dated 06/24/24 to 07/01/24, revealed 13 instances where wait times were greater than 15 minutes.


A review of call light logs for Resident 2, dated 06/24/24 to 07/01/24, revealed seven instances where wait times were greater than 15 minutes.


In an electronic communication recieved on 07/08/24, Staff 3 (Administrator) stated the facility's posted staffing plan reflected the minimum staffing required based on census.


The findings were reviewed with and acknowledged by Staff 1 on 07/01/24.


The facility failed to fully implement and update an Acuity Based Staffing Tool.
